Select the correct answer. What is the main reason you should know the meaning of every word in a short story as opposed to a no
3241004551 [841]

The correct answer is C.

One characteristic of short stories is the great amount of symbolism that can be found in them.

Since novels do not have a word limit, the author can spend paragraphs or even full chapters describing settings and characters' personalities, looks and pasts. These may include a variety of words that we may not actually know but can infer from context.

While novels <em>may </em>have a symbolic meaning, it is much more difficult to analyse them in such a long story.

On the other hand, the briefness of short stories allow them to include a great amount of symbolism that can be much more easily analysed.

But to understand them, it is necessary to understand the meaning of each word, since they may be key to figure out a symbol within the story.

How does Britain and Jamaica history influence how levy and her family feel about themselves, their home, and their community?
BARSIC [14]

The history of Britain and Jamaica influences Levy and his family's feelings about themselves and their community, in the sense of portraying the contrast between cultures and the way immigrants are treated.

<h3>Synopsis</h3>

In the reflective essay "Back to My Own Country" author Andrea Levy seeks ways to understand more about Caribbean culture and structural issues of society, such as racism, in relation to immigrants.

Therefore, the author searches through her experiences and observations about immigrants in Great Britain, reporting how discrimination occurred in relation to the color, accent and physical characteristics, making this people marginalized and excluded from social issues.
